Output e3bf73855f28e3b4a83c479eec29b72fcad6b58e5ed16f05526c3ae5c9ed90e5:21

value
39398
script pubkey
OP_0 OP_PUSHBYTES_20 8e1897bbf0620e1c6491a2a693bebcd571c585f3
address
bc1q3cvf0wlsvg8pcey352nf804u64cutp0nl8zg75
transaction
e3bf73855f28e3b4a83c479eec29b72fcad6b58e5ed16f05526c3ae5c9ed90e5
confirmations
140001
spent
true